Transaction 13458d869d21288102f935ce91ffa56b5108a92a491dc2dd227c9833746a5619
1 Input
1 Output
-
13458d869d21288102f935ce91ffa56b5108a92a491dc2dd227c9833746a5619:0
- value
- 577767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 139426cb35ef33d97caee73e8572ab50efb9fbd1 OP_EQUAL
- address
- 33UYEwMFWzYvEAyDtJHUhn6C9asDQ9j6GZ